在信息化时代,数据已成为企业的重要资产。为了确保数据质量和业务流程的透明度,全链路追踪技术应运而生。本文将深入解析全链路追踪技术,探讨其在实现数据全流程可视化方面的关键作用。
一、全链路追踪技术概述
全链路追踪技术,即End-to-End Tracing,是一种跟踪和分析分布式系统性能的技术。它通过记录数据从产生、传输、处理到消费的全过程,实现数据全流程的可视化。全链路追踪技术广泛应用于金融、电商、云计算等领域,有助于提升系统性能、优化业务流程、降低运维成本。
二、全链路追踪技术的核心优势
- 数据全流程可视化
全链路追踪技术能够全面记录数据在系统中的流转过程,包括数据来源、处理节点、传输路径等。这使得企业可以直观地了解数据在各个阶段的表现,从而实现数据全流程的可视化。
- 诊断问题、优化性能
通过全链路追踪技术,企业可以实时监测系统性能,快速定位问题。当系统出现异常时,全链路追踪技术能够帮助开发者快速找到问题根源,并针对性地进行优化,提高系统稳定性。
- 提升用户体验
全链路追踪技术有助于企业实时掌握用户行为数据,从而优化产品功能和用户体验。通过对用户行为的深入分析,企业可以针对性地调整产品策略,提升用户满意度。
- 降低运维成本
全链路追踪技术可以实现自动化监控,减少人工干预。同时,通过对系统性能的实时监控,企业可以提前发现潜在问题,降低运维成本。
三、全链路追踪技术的实现方式
- 开源追踪工具
目前,市场上已有许多开源的全链路追踪工具,如Zipkin、Jaeger等。这些工具具备良好的性能和可扩展性,能够满足大部分企业的需求。
- 自研追踪系统
对于一些对数据安全性和定制化要求较高的企业,可以考虑自研追踪系统。自研追踪系统可以根据企业实际需求进行定制,确保数据安全和业务合规。
- 第三方服务
一些云服务提供商也提供了全链路追踪服务,如阿里云、腾讯云等。企业可以根据自身业务需求选择合适的第三方服务,实现全链路追踪。
四、全链路追踪技术的应用场景
- 业务监控
企业可以通过全链路追踪技术,实时监控业务流程,确保业务顺利进行。
- 系统性能优化
通过对系统性能的实时监控,企业可以及时发现瓶颈,优化系统性能。
- 安全审计
全链路追踪技术可以帮助企业进行安全审计,确保数据安全和业务合规。
- 用户体验优化
通过对用户行为的分析,企业可以优化产品功能和用户体验。
五、总结
全链路追踪技术是实现数据全流程可视化的关键。它有助于企业提升系统性能、优化业务流程、降低运维成本。随着技术的不断发展,全链路追踪技术将在更多领域发挥重要作用。